What the Musk vs. Springsteen Feud Reveals About America’s Political Landscape

Placeholder image for Musk mocks America-hating idiot Springsteen

Elon Musk vs. Bruce Springsteen: The Battle of Perspectives

In a recent public spat, tech magnate Elon Musk labeled legendary musician Bruce Springsteen an "America-hating idiot," igniting heated conversations among conservatives and political commentators alike. The clash reflects a broader narrative involving prominent figures in politics and entertainment, each vying to portray their vision of America during a tumultuous political climate.

The Political Context Behind the Feud

This feud comes against a backdrop of ongoing tensions between various cultural icons and political leaders. Springsteen, famous for his blue-collar anthems and advocacy for social justice, has not shied away from criticizing the current political climate and administration. At a recent concert, he condemned what he called a "corrupt, incompetent, and treasonous" government, likely referencing not just the Trump administration but also ongoing policies by current leaders.
Meanwhile, Musk, known for his bold statements and sometimes controversial opinions, sees Springsteen's commentary as an attack on American values, turning the dialogue into a curious intersection between politics, celebrity, and public sentiment.

Springsteen’s Critique of American Politics

Springsteen’s tirades against Donald Trump and his administration have garnered attention for their raw emotional appeal, emphasizing themes that resonate with many working-class Americans. In his performances, he often harkens back to the struggles faced by ordinary citizens, positioning himself as a voice for the downtrodden. His line of attack extends to corporate elites like Musk, indicating that the wealth and power held by these figures contribute to societal inequities and a threatened democracy.
This dichotomy—celebrity critique against political leadership—reveals how music can serve as a powerful vehicle for political expression.

Musk's Response and The Conservative Perspective

Musk's criticism of Springsteen resonates deeply within conservative circles, particularly in New Jersey, where dissatisfaction with the Democratic establishment runs high. Characters like Matt Rooney of the Save Jersey blog frequently echo sentiments shared by constituents who feel sidelined by political debates dominated by elite voices. For these individuals, Musk’s stance means standing up against perceived elitism depicted by figures like Springsteen. This dynamic has fostered a rich field for conversations about who truly represents the public in these charged political times.

The Role of Social Media in Amplifying Political Speech

The exchange between Musk and Springsteen showcases how social media and public platforms can amplify political voices. Through posts and tweets, both personalities reach massive audiences, shaping narratives and influencing voter opinions, notably in states like New Jersey where political engagement is critical for the upcoming gubernatorial and legislative races. People are talking about Governor Murphy's policies, school funding, and property taxes—all key issues affecting the everyday lives of residents.
This modern communication landscape has made it easier for individuals to engage in political debates, share differing viewpoints, and rally sympathy for their causes.

What This Feud Means for the Future of Political Discourse

The Musk-Springsteen encounter underscores a growing trend where cultural and political conflicts intersect, often stirring reactions among the public. It has opened pathways for voters to consider the merits of both sides. For the Republicans and conservatives, it’s about promoting values of accountability and examining who actually speaks for working-class concerns.
As the 2024 elections loom closer, such debates will likely gain momentum, compelling voters to examine the implications of policies and the personalities behind them.

NJ Lawsuit Over Christian Club: A Landmark Case for School Policies

Update A Legal Battle That Might Change the Landscape of School Religious GroupsThe recent lawsuit against the Hopewell Valley Regional School District brings to light a critical examination of the federal Equal Access Act and its implications for religious groups in public education. The Fellowship of Christian Athletes (FCA) has initiated this legal challenge, contending that the district has discriminated against them by prohibiting outside volunteers while allowing other student organizations the freedom to do so. This case underscores a national debate on the balance between religious freedom and the secular nature of public education. The Heart of the Matter: Equal Access vs. Student LeadershipCentrally to the lawsuit is whether the district's rules correctly enforce constitutional limits on public school religious clubs. The FCA argues that the restrictions are unfairly targeted at religious organizations. Conversely, the Freedom From Religion Foundation posits that maintaining a student-led initiative is essential and crucial to uphold the constitutional separation of church and state. This tension plays out in schools nationwide, making Hopewell Valley a focal point for similar cases across the country. Community Reactions and the Implications for New Jersey Public PolicyAs the lawsuit unfolds, the responses from community members are mixed. Many parents and educators support the notion of inclusion for all student organizations, emphasizing the importance of inclusivity and community spirit in educational environments. Others, however, raise concerns about the implications for religious expression within public schools, fearing that a ruling in favor of the FCA could open the door for more religious activities that could overshadow secular events. The case's outcome could significantly impact how New Jersey public policy addresses religious groups in schools, potentially redefining the landscape of school activities as well as policies governing student rights. It's not just a local concern; as this case progresses, it may influence similar legislation across the nation, which underscores the importance of this legal battle. Understanding the Broader Context of Religious Freedom in EducationThis lawsuit reflects a broader societal conversation regarding religious freedoms and their place within taxpayer-funded education. While Hopewell Valley boasts impressive academic achievement, with high proficiency rates and a 97% graduation rate, the implications of this case may challenge that reputation. It raises questions about inclusivity, representation, and how educational spaces can accommodate diverse beliefs and practices. By spotlighting this lawsuit, New Jersey is at the forefront of a national discourse about what it means to be inclusive in educational settings, particularly regarding faith-based groups. As more cases emerge from various states, this situation highlights the necessity for schools to navigate the complexities of religious expression carefully, ensuring both rights and responsibilities are respected. Looking Ahead: What Comes Next for New Jersey Schools?As civic leaders and policymakers keep a close eye on the developments from this case, the potential for changes in New Jersey’s education policy could resonate long beyond state lines. The backdrop of the lawsuit reveals a growing awareness and sensitivity regarding the intersection of education and religion, prompting stakeholders to engage in meaningful dialogue about the rights of students and the role of schools in fostering diverse community values. The ruling could prompt schools to reevaluate their policies regarding outside volunteers and the extent of religious activities allowed on campuses.
